Ordinals
beta
Sat 361873986314752
decimal
12538.5186314752
percentile
0.7237479726295041%
name
mmpgqpialmez
cycle
0
epoch
2
block
12538
offset
5186314752
timestamp
2023-12-14 19:40:49 UTC
rarity
common
prev
next